## Changelog — ReminderRunner v2.4

Quick one for you, release manager: we renamed the old CLINIC_NOTIFY_KEY setting because it kept confusing people — half the team thought it toggled notifications, the other half thought it was a credential (it's the latter). The Maplewell Clinic reminder job now reads REMINDER_DISPATCH_SECRET instead, and the old name is fully removed, no fallback. Update the prod env file accordingly; the new value should be placed on the line right after this entry.

sealed setting: VAULT_KEY20=c8ea1e419912889df6b4

## Onboarding — Markdown Pipeline (Inkmere)

Inkmere docs render through a three-stage pipeline: parse, sanitize, emit. Releases rebuild all templates; never hot-patch emitted HTML. Broken renders usually mean a sanitizer rule change — check the rules diff first. The render cluster only accepts builds from the release channel, and every build artifact must be signed before upload. Sign artifacts with the deploy key below.

release key, hafop-tajef: bky13_s2vaFVNJTHfBL

Capacity note: the Lintgrove baseline file grows roughly 4 KB per thousand suppressed findings. Past 50 MB, parse time dominates CI startup and the cache layer thrashes. Prune quarterly; don't bump the cap reactively at 3 a.m. without paging the tooling lead. The enforced limits currently loaded by the analyzer are the following.

limits module of yahif-tawif:
BUDGETS = {
    "ulays": 902,
    "kelael": 492,
    "ralix": 488,
    "oliok": 420,
    "wenmir": 757,
    "casath": 178,
    "eliir": 272,
}